
HTML设置字体为艺术字的方法有:使用CSS样式、利用Google Fonts、应用SVG字体。 其中,使用CSS样式是最常见且最灵活的方式。通过CSS样式,可以自定义字体的大小、颜色、阴影、变形等效果,从而达到艺术字的效果。下面将详细介绍如何使用CSS样式来设置艺术字。
一、使用CSS样式
CSS(层叠样式表)是控制HTML元素样式的标准方式,通过CSS可以灵活地控制文字的外观。以下是几种常见的CSS属性及其效果:
1、字体大小和颜色
通过 font-size 和 color 属性,可以设置字体的大小和颜色。
.art-font {
font-size: 2em;
color: #3498db;
}
在HTML中应用:
<p class="art-font">这是艺术字</p>
2、文字阴影
通过 text-shadow 属性,可以为文字添加阴影效果,使其更具立体感。
.art-font-shadow {
font-size: 2em;
color: #e74c3c;
text-shadow: 2px 2px 4px #000000;
}
在HTML中应用:
<p class="art-font-shadow">这是带阴影的艺术字</p>
3、字体变形
通过 transform 属性,可以对文字进行旋转、缩放等变形操作。
.art-font-transform {
font-size: 2em;
color: #2ecc71;
transform: rotate(-10deg);
}
在HTML中应用:
<p class="art-font-transform">这是旋转的艺术字</p>
二、利用Google Fonts
Google Fonts提供了大量免费的字体,可以直接在HTML中引用并使用。
1、引入Google Fonts
在HTML文件的 <head> 部分添加以下代码:
<link href="https://fonts.googleapis.com/css2?family=Lobster&display=swap" rel="stylesheet">
2、使用自定义字体
在CSS中使用引入的字体:
.art-font-google {
font-family: 'Lobster', cursive;
font-size: 2em;
color: #8e44ad;
}
在HTML中应用:
<p class="art-font-google">这是Google字体的艺术字</p>
三、应用SVG字体
SVG(可缩放矢量图形)是一种用于描述二维矢量图形的XML语言,使用SVG可以创建更复杂的艺术字效果。
1、创建SVG字体
可以使用在线工具如FontForge或Adobe Illustrator来创建SVG字体,并导出为SVG文件。
2、在HTML中嵌入SVG字体
将生成的SVG文件内容嵌入到HTML中:
<svg xmlns="http://www.w3.org/2000/svg" version="1.1" width="300" height="100">
<text x="10" y="40" font-family="Verdana" font-size="35" fill="blue">艺术字</text>
</svg>
通过这种方式,可以精确控制每个字母的形状和颜色。
四、结合多种方法
实际应用中,可以结合多种方法来实现复杂的艺术字效果。例如,可以先使用Google Fonts引入字体,再通过CSS对其进行变形和添加阴影。
.art-font-combined {
font-family: 'Lobster', cursive;
font-size: 2.5em;
color: #e67e22;
text-shadow: 3px 3px 5px #34495e;
transform: skew(10deg, 10deg);
}
在HTML中应用:
<p class="art-font-combined">这是结合多种方法的艺术字</p>
五、艺术字在项目中的应用
在项目开发中,艺术字通常用于标题、标语等需要突出显示的文字部分。为了更好地管理和协作,建议使用项目管理系统如研发项目管理系统PingCode和通用项目协作软件Worktile。这些系统可以帮助团队更有效地管理任务、文档和沟通,从而提高项目的开发效率。
1、研发项目管理系统PingCode
PingCode是一款专注于研发项目管理的系统,提供了丰富的功能来支持团队协作。通过PingCode,可以轻松管理项目任务、跟踪进度,并与团队成员进行有效的沟通。
2、通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。通过Worktile,可以创建任务清单、设置截止日期、分配任务,并实时跟踪项目进展。
六、总结
HTML设置字体为艺术字的方法有多种,包括使用CSS样式、利用Google Fonts和应用SVG字体。使用CSS样式是最常见且最灵活的方式,通过调整字体大小、颜色、阴影、变形等属性,可以实现丰富的艺术字效果。在项目开发中,建议结合项目管理系统如PingCode和Worktile,以提高团队协作和项目管理的效率。
通过掌握上述方法,您可以在网页设计中灵活地应用艺术字,提升页面的视觉效果和用户体验。
相关问答FAQs:
1. 如何在HTML中设置字体为艺术字?
可以通过使用CSS样式来设置字体为艺术字。首先,您需要在网上找到您喜欢的艺术字体的字体文件(通常是.woff或.ttf格式)。然后,将字体文件上传到您的服务器上,并在您的HTML文件中引入该字体文件。最后,使用CSS的font-family属性将字体应用到您想要的元素上。
2. 我在HTML中设置了字体为艺术字,但在不同的浏览器上显示效果不一样怎么办?
不同浏览器对字体的渲染方式可能不同,导致在不同浏览器上显示效果不同。为了解决这个问题,您可以尝试使用Web字体(Web Fonts)服务,比如Google Fonts。这些服务提供了跨浏览器兼容的字体,您可以直接在HTML中引入它们,以确保在不同浏览器上都能正确显示您的艺术字体。
3. 除了使用CSS样式设置字体为艺术字,还有其他方法吗?
除了使用CSS样式,您还可以考虑使用图像替代字体的方法。这意味着您将每个字符都转换为一个图片,并将这些图片作为文字的替代品。尽管这种方法可以确保在任何浏览器上都能显示相同的艺术字体效果,但它可能会增加网页的加载时间和带宽消耗。因此,如果您选择使用这种方法,请确保优化图像大小和加载速度,以提供更好的用户体验。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3053805